Raymond Carlos Nakai (born April 16, 1946) is a Native American flutist of Navajo and Ute heritage. His cross-cultural collaborations have included an album with the Wind Travelin Band, a Japanese folk ensemble and Tibetan flutist and singer Nawang Khechog on several productions including In A Distant Place. Nakai has earned two gold records for Canyon Trilogy and Earth Spirit and has received eleven GRAMMY nominations in four different categories and earned a Governors Arts Award. In addition to his solo appearances throughout the United States, Europe, and Japan, Nakai has worked with guitarist William Eaton, flutist Paul Horn, composers James DeMars and Phillip Glass and various symphony orchestras. He was awarded the Arizona Governors Arts Award in 1992 and an honorary doctorate from Northern Arizona University in 1994. In addition to his solo appearances throughout the United States, Europe, and Japan, Nakai has worked with guitarist William Eaton, pianist Peter Kater, the classical ensemble Tos, and various symphonies; founded the classical jazz ensemble Jackalope; and released an album, Island of Bows, with Wind Travelin Band, a traditional Japanese ensemble from Kyoto. R. CARLOS NAKAI Of Navajo-Ute heritage, R. Carlos Nakai is the world's premier performer of the Native American flute. In 2014,Canyon Trilogy reached Platinum (over 1 million units sold), the first ever for a Native American artist performing traditional solo flute music. Nakai began playing the traditional Native American flute in the early 1980s and released more than 50 albums in his career (with 40 on the Canyon Records label).
